チェコ共和国での減量外科費用について今すぐご確認ください

チェコ共和国における減量手術の費用は、平均して $11,200 から $20,100 が一般的です。最終的な費用は、具体的な術式、入院期間、および使用される技術的アプローチによって異なります。チェコのクリニックを選択することで、アメリカ合衆国と比較して50〜70%の費用削減が見込まれる場合があります。

チェコ共和国における減量手術の標準的な費用

  • 治療計画作成を含む診察: $41 – $200
  • 胃内バルーン: $3,200 – $4,300
  • 腹腔鏡下スリーブ状胃切除術: $10,000 – $15,000
  • 胃バイパス術: $14,000 – $22,000
  • 内視鏡的スリーブ胃形成術(ESG): $4,800 – $7,200
  • 胃切除術: $18,000 – $28,000
  • 胃バンド術: $6,000 – $9,000
  • 代謝手術: $8,500 – $11,500
  • 肥満手術後の形成外科手術: $8,000 – $14,000
  • ダ・ヴィンチ腹腔鏡下スリーブ状胃切除術: $8,000 – $12,000

プラハ、ヴェルケー・メジジーチー、およびトゥルノフは、肥満外科手術における主要な医療拠点となっています。プラハでの手術費用は概して全国中央値を示す一方、小都市の医療施設ではやや競争力のある価格が提示される場合があります。個別の症例に応じた正確な費用については、専門医にご相談ください。

この医師はSt. Zdislava Hospitalの院長であり、Robotic Surgery Centerの副主任医師です。2004年から肥満外科を専門としており、肥満治療にDa Vinciロボットを使用し、皮膚の引き締めやヘルニア除去を含む前腹壁の手術を行っています。

腫瘍外科のバックグラウンドを持ち、BrnoのOncological Surgical Hospitalでの勤務経験が豊富です。外科の1級認定を持ち、上級医師および外科部門の責任者としてのライセンスを有しています。教育にはMasaryk Universityでの一般医学の学位と、Cambridge Business School PragueでのMBAが含まれます。

What are the eligibility criteria for weight-loss (bariatric) surgery in the Czech Republic?

Bariatric surgery eligibility in the Czech Republic requires a body mass index (BMI) of 40 or higher. Patients with BMI between 35 and 40 also qualify if they have obesity-related conditions like type 2 diabetes or hypertension. Candidates must demonstrate previous unsuccessful weight-loss attempts through diet or exercise.

  • Age requirements: Surgery is typically performed on patients aged 18 to 60.
  • Health conditions: Qualifiers include sleep apnea, joint issues, or metabolic disorders.
  • Psychological screening: Mandatory evaluations confirm mental readiness and realistic post-operative expectations.
  • Clinical tests: Patients must pass blood work, ECG, and abdominal ultrasound exams.

Which bariatric procedures are routinely offered to international patients and how do they differ?

Routine bariatric procedures in the Czech Republic include gastric sleeve surgery, gastric bypass, and gastric banding. These methods vary by their impact on stomach volume and nutrient absorption. Advanced options like Da Vinci robotic surgery and endoscopic sleeve gastroplasty (ESG) are also available for international patients.

  • Gastric sleeve: Removes 80% of the stomach to limit food intake and reduce hunger.
  • Gastric bypass: Reroutes the small intestine to restrict calories and change metabolic hormone levels.
  • Gastric balloon: A temporary, non-surgical procedure involving a saline-filled balloon to trigger early fullness.
  • Robotic surgery: Centers use Da Vinci systems for higher precision and faster post-operative recovery.

What complications or long-term risks should I be aware of after bariatric surgery in the Czech Republic?

Bariatric surgery in the Czech Republic is safe. Most procedures use minimally invasive or robotic techniques. Long-term risks include nutritional deficiencies and gastroesophageal reflux. Patients often require lifelong vitamin supplementation. Specialized centers like the Robotic Surgery Center in St. Zdislava Hospital manage these risks with advanced technology.

  • Nutritional deficiencies: Up to 50% of patients require lifelong iron and B12 supplements.
  • Gastroesophageal reflux: Approximately 17.3% of sleeve gastrectomy patients report chronic acid reflux.
  • Dumping syndrome: Rapid digestion causes nausea or dizziness after eating sugar or carbs.

What post-operative care and follow-up schedule can medical tourists expect, and how is it handled if I return home?

Weight loss surgery patients in the Czech Republic typically stay in-country for 7 to 14 days for initial recovery. This period includes vital sign monitoring, drain removal, and wound checks. Post-discharge care transitions to telehealth consultations and coordination with a local primary physician for long-term monitoring.

  • In-patient stay: Surgeons monitor anesthesia recovery and vitals for the first 24 to 48 hours.
  • Early recovery: Doctors typically remove surgical drains and check incisions between days 3 and 7.
  • Flight clearance: Patients receive fit-to-fly authorization after a final in-person check around day 14.
  • Remote monitoring: Follow-up continues via video calls or WhatsApp for 4 to 12 weeks post-surgery.

What is the typical duration of stay and travel logistics for weight-loss surgery in the Czech Republic?

Patients typically stay in the Czech Republic for 7 to 14 days for weight loss surgery. This timeframe includes 2 to 3 nights of hospitalization for monitoring. Most surgeons require a 7 to 10-day recovery period before clearing patients for international flights to reduce travel risks.

  • Hospital stay: Most patients spend 2 to 3 nights hospitalized for post-operative care.
  • Recovery period: Surgeons recommend staying in the country for 7 to 10 additional days.
  • Arrival point: Patients usually fly into Prague Václav Havel Airport for the best clinic access.
  • Follow-up timing: A mandatory 1-week follow-up appointment is standard before departing the country.

Are bariatric operations in the Czech Republic performed laparoscopically, and will the scars be visible?

Bariatric surgeries in the Czech Republic are performed using laparoscopic and robotic techniques. Surgeons use 4–6 small incisions between 0.5 and 1.2 cm long. These minimally invasive methods ensure faster recovery. Most scars fade into thin white lines within 12 months after the procedure.

  • Surgical technique: Laparoscopic and robotic Da Vinci systems are standard for weight loss procedures.
  • Incision size: Operations require 4–6 tiny punctures usually 5–12 mm in length.
  • Scar placement: Surgeons often place incisions in the navel or natural folds to hide them.
  • Recovery time: Patients typically feel well enough to travel 700 km by the fourth day.
